What does Nasonex contain?
Nasonex contains Mometasone as the active ingredient.
Uses of Nasonex
Nasonex is used for the treatment of:
- Allergic symptoms like sneezing, itching and stuffy/runny nose
- Asthma
- Hay fever
- Nasal polyps (growths inside the nose)

How Does Nasonex Work?
Nasonex works by blocking the chemical substances in the body which are responsible for inflammation and allergic reactions.
How to Take Nasonex?
After removing the protective cap and closing one nostril by finger tilt your head slightly forward. Now insert the nasal applicator into your other nostril and press the pump to release the medication into your nose, repeat the same process with the other nostril.

Common Dosage for Nasonex?
Nasonex is generally prescribed once or twice daily. Your doctor may alter your dosage and its frequency depending upon the severity of your condition.
When to Avoid Nasonex?
Avoid Nasonex if:
- You are allergic to any component of Nasonex
- You have eye disease
- You have tuberculosis
- You have herpes eye infection
- You have encountered a recent nose injury or surgery
Side Effects of Nasonex
Some of the reported side effects of Nasonex are:
- Dryness or irritation in nose or throat
- Blood in mucus/phlegm
- Bleeding of nose
- Trouble swallowing
- Dizziness
- Fatigue
- Loss of weight
- Feet or ankle swelling
- Headache
- Increased urination and thirst
- Vision disturbances

Are There Any Reported Allergic Reactions?
Some of the common allergic reactions reported with Nasonex are hives, difficulty breathing, and sw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at.

Effects/Results After Consuming Nasonex
The effect of Nasonex can be observed within 1 to 2 days of administration but it may take up to 2 weeks to show the full effect. Your allergic and inflammatory symptoms will start to improve after taking Nasonex.

Is Nasonex addictive?
Nasonex is not addictive in nature
Can I have Nasonex with alcohol?
It is better to avoid alcohol when on Nasonex. Consult your doctor about limiting alcohol with this medication. Co-consumption of alcohol with Nasonex causes excessive sleepiness and drowsiness.
Any particular food item to be avoided?
You must consult your doctor regarding the foods to be avoided.
Can I have Nasonex when pregnant?
In most cases, it is not safe to take Nasonex if you are pregnant or planning a pregnancy. Consult your doctor if it is absolutely necessary to take this medication.
Can I have Nasonex when feeding a baby?
Nasonex is known to pass in mother’s milk to the baby. Consult your doctor if it is absolutely necessary to take this medication while you are breastfeeding.
Can I drive after taking Nasonex?
It is generally safe to drive while taking Nasonex. However, if you experience drowsiness, dizziness, a headache or any side effect that alters your consciousness then it may not be safe to drive.
What happens if I overdose on Nasonex?
An overdose of Nasonex will not improve your symptoms. It may even cause serious side-effects like stomach pain, n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ea. Consult your doctor immediately in case of overdose.
What happens if I eat expired Nasonex?
If by mistake you consume a dose of expired Nasonex, the chances of harm are very less. It is advised to check the label for expiry date always before use.
What happens if I miss a dose of Nasonex?
As soon as you remember, take the missed dose. However, if it is already time for next dose, carry on with your regular schedule. Do not take a double dose to make up for the missed dose.

Pro Tips When Taking Nasonex
- Do not try to self-adjust the dose. Take it in the quantity prescribed by your doctor.
- Do not share your medication with anyone even if they have a similar condition.
- Discuss the pros and cons of Nasonex if you are pregnant or planning a pregnancy or if you are breastfeeding.
- Do not blow your nose within 15 minutes of administration of this spray.
- You must shake the medicine container well before using it.
